Total Time: 25 minsCategory: MainsCalories: 225 per serving1. Slice beef thinly against the grain. (Note 3)
2. Place in a bowl. Sprinkle over baking soda, toss with fingers to coat evenly.
3. Refrigerate for 30 to 40 minutes. (See Note 1 for different cuts)
4. Rinse beef well with tap water. Shake off excess water, then use paper towels to blot away excess water (doesn't need to be 100% dry).

How to make low carb beef schnitzel?

The perfect Low Carb Beef Schnitzel requires thinly sliced meat if you can't get your meat thinly sliced then grab a meat mallet. Place your steak between two pieces of parchment paper and beat the steak until it is between 5-8mm thin. Turn your deep fryer to 350F/180C and allow to heat before frying.

How do you make gravy from breaded beef cutlets?

To make your own gravy: Melt 4 tablespoons butter in a small saucepan. Whisk in 2 tablespoons flour, salt and pepper, and ¼ teaspoon garlic salt. Slowly add 1 cup light cream, whisking continually.
